Have you ever achieved a major goal… and then woken up the next day feeling like the same old version of yourself?You finally get the promotion. You heal a relationship. You step into visibility.Your life upgrades — but your identity hasn’t caught up yet.In this deep dive, Jared and Alicia explore a powerful concept called Identity Lag: the temporary gap between external change and internal self-concept.Using neuroscience, psychology, and spiritual insight, they unpack why the nervous system resists sudden expansion — even when that expansion is exactly what we wanted.Through historical stories, personal experiences, and practical tools, you’ll learn how to gently help your identity integrate the growth that has already occurred in your life.Because sometimes the discomfort you feel after success isn’t failure…It’s transformation in progress.In this episode you’ll discover:• Why success can trigger imposter syndrome • The neuroscience behind identity change and neuroplasticity• How your nervous system mistakes novelty for danger• The four-step Name the Upgrade integration practice• How to debug resistance when your identity hasn’t caught up• A powerful guided visualization to meet your integrated future selfIf you’ve ever felt like your life changed but you didn’t, this episode will help you understand why.And more importantly — how to grow into the life that is already unfolding around you.Soundbite Takeaway“Sometimes your life upgrades before your identity does.”Try This This WeekIdentify one area of your life where growth has already happened.Then take one small action that reflects the identity that matches that reality.You don’t have to become that person overnight.Just grow into it.Next EpisodeIn Episode 112 we explore Living in Beta — what happens when you stop trying to finalize your identity and instead begin evolving it consciously.Resources Mentioned• Narrative Identity Theory – Dan McAdams• Self-Schema Theory – Hazel Markus• Neuroplasticity – Norman Doidge• Constructed Emotion Theory – Lisa Feldman Barrett• Polyvagal Theory – Stephen Porges• Transition Theory – William BridgesJoin the Community📩 Want the prompts delivered each week?
